Firmware

Optra Edge devices run portal-managed firmware that is updated over the air. The portal tracks each device's current firmware version and notifies you when an update is available.


Checking the firmware version

The current firmware version is displayed in two places:

  • Devices list — shown in the device row under the Firmware Version column.
  • Device detail → Overview tab — shown in the device summary at the top.

Updating firmware

When a newer firmware version is available for a device, an Update Firmware button or badge appears in the device detail view.

Update a single device

  1. Open the device detail view.
  2. Click Update Firmware.
  3. Confirm the update in the dialog that appears.

The device will download and apply the new firmware. During the update, the device briefly reboots. The status indicator shows Updating throughout this process.

Bulk firmware update

You can update firmware on multiple devices at once from the Devices list:

  1. Select the devices you want to update (use the checkbox on each row, or select all).
  2. Click Update Firmware in the bulk actions bar.
  3. Confirm the update.

All selected devices will be updated to their latest available firmware versions.


Firmware update statuses

After an update is triggered, the device progresses through a series of statuses:

StatusMeaning
RequestingThe update request has been sent to the device
DownloadingThe device is downloading the firmware package
DownloadedThe download is complete; waiting to apply
ApplyingThe firmware is being written to the device
RebootingThe device is restarting after applying the update
ReadyThe device is running the new firmware successfully
ErrorThe update failed — see Troubleshooting below

The status is shown in the device detail header while an update is in progress.


Release notes

When updating firmware, you can review the release notes for the new version in the update dialog. Release notes describe what changed and any important notes about the update.


Troubleshooting firmware updates

IssueWhat to do
Status stuck on RequestingThe device may be offline. Check that it shows Online in the Devices list. Once it reconnects, it will pick up the update request.
Status shows ErrorThe update failed. Try triggering the update again from the device detail view. If it fails repeatedly, check the Device Logs for error messages.
Update button not visibleThe device is already running the latest firmware, or it is currently updating.
Device offline after updateA firmware update causes a brief reboot. Wait a few minutes for the device to reconnect. If it does not come back online, check the device's physical network connection.
